1. Protocol Loop v1 (2026)
Overview: This is the core technical build for 2026, aimed at making the hybrid protocol work end-to-end without manual intervention. Key components include automated contributor screening and data anchoring, a hybrid delivery system that combines decentralized truth with cloud-based "hot paths" for speed, and the first versions of access control, metering, and a royalty engine. Crucially, this loop is designed to integrate real $XNY utility into production data pathways (Codatta).

2. Network Loop Activation (2026)
Overview: This initiative focuses on activating Codatta's existing base of over 1 million KYC-verified contributors. The goal is to transform this group into a credentialed "quality engine" through an identity ladder, expert specialization tracks, and the formation of 20+ regional pods. The process will emphasize evidence-heavy qualification and quality control (QC) to provide enterprises with auditable proof of data provenance and contributor reputation (Codatta).

3. Business Loop Scaling (2026)
Overview: The final loop is about driving commercial growth beyond pilot projects. Codatta plans to scale commercialization by expanding from its current proven workloads into repeatable industry verticals, specifically naming healthcare and robotics. A key milestone is closing "lighthouse customers" – flagship clients whose demands will force improvements in real-world reliability and system robustness (Codatta).
